Explore this impressive 260+/- acre agricultural property offering organic hay production, recreational opportunities, and buildable potential. This property is four contiguous parcels, with no leases or conservation limitations. With 64+/- acres of tillable, between 100–125 round bales of Timothy, clover, Crown vetch, and brome grasses are produced annually—ideal for organic farming or small-scale agricultural pursuits. Access comes via an EASEMENT AGREEMENT THAT IS NOW RECORDED and begins at a gated entrance along a gravel and dirt drive. Upon reaching the location of the old farmhouse and outbuildings, you’re welcomed with a stunning panoramic view! The property is partially fenced and also has miles of historic rock walls that stretch across the landscape, lending character and charm. Stony Run winds through the acreage for about ½ mile, and there are also a couple of frog ponds—an excellent setting for early morning coffee and peaceful wildlife observation. A portion of the tract was logged in the spring of 2025, opening up scenic views. The acreage that was logged had previously been tillable and, with further clearing, could be returned to pasture or hay production. While cattle haven’t grazed here since 2008, the layout supports future livestock use. The mineral rights do convey, except for tract 1, which have been reserved and can be redeemed in the year 2031. At the heart of the property sits an uninhabitable five bedroom farmhouse, which could be considered for renovation or repurposing. The location provides privacy and remarkable views, electricity is available, the water is spring fed, and no sewer or septic. Nearby is the barn that could use some repair, but still showcases the original beams. Additional outbuildings offer storage or workshop potential. With agricultural zoning, the property offers flexibility—continue organic hay production, raise livestock, or recreate this land as a private retreat. This is a rare opportunity for prime commercial investment in Western Maryland’s high-visibility gateway corridor. Located within the Willow Brook Road Extension Project, this site has been designated a strategic “Development/Investment Opportunity Site” in the city’s long-term growth plan. This 15.47-acre property offers exceptional visibility and accessibility, situated just 0.3 miles from Interstate 68 with significant road frontage on Willow Brook Road. Within city limits, it benefits from direct access to major regional facilities, ensuring a steady flow of traffic and solidifying its position as a key gateway transit route for the region. Additionally, it is just 2 miles from Downtown Cumberland’s Revitalization Project—a recently completed $16 million enhancement that has garnered national attention and become a point of pride for residents as well as a must-see urban destination for visitors. Optimally positioned and annexed into Business Commercial (BC) zoning, this property offers significant development flexibility, making it ideal for a variety of commercial ventures. The site includes a historic two-story structure, multiple outbuildings, and over 7 acres of cleared land, with central areas featuring favorable topography and soil conditions for development. With an Annual Average Daily Traffic (AADT) of over 10,000 vehicles on Willow Brook Road frontage alone—not including traffic that can be captured from Interstate 68 —this location is poised for commercial growth. Additionally, local and regional incentives and resources are available to support development.
